As the largest economy in Southeast Asia, Indonesia is undergoing rapid industrial growth. Large manufacturing corridors across Bekasi, Karawang, Surabaya, and Tangerang, combined with extensive agricultural processing (such as palm oil and rubber refineries), generate vast quantities of complex wastewater. In response, the Indonesian Ministry of Environment and Forestry (KLHK) has implemented strict wastewater quality standards—notably under Regulation No. P.68/Menlhk/Setjen/Kum.1/8/2016. This framework imposes strict limits on parameters such as Chemical Oxygen Demand (COD), Biological Oxygen Demand (BOD), Total Suspended Solids (TSS), and crucially, Total Nitrogen (TN) and Ammonia-Nitrogen (NH₃-N).
Removing nitrogen through biological denitrification is essential for local compliance. Biological denitrification involves the reduction of nitrate (NO₃⁻) to gaseous nitrogen (N₂) by facultative anaerobic microorganisms. However, many Indonesian industrial processes (especially in chemical, petrochemical, and municipal sectors) yield wastewater with low carbon-to-nitrogen (C:N) ratios, which limits this process. Without an added external carbon source, denitrification efficiency drops, leading to excessive nitrate levels in the effluent and regulatory penalties.
In biological wastewater treatment plants, nitrogen elimination is a two-step biological process: aerobic nitrification followed by anoxic denitrification. Denitrifying bacteria require a reliable carbon source as an electron donor to fuel the biochemical reduction steps:
For industrial applications, choosing the right carbon source affects both kinetic reaction rates and overall operation costs. Sodium acetate (CH₃COONa) is widely utilized due to its direct path into the acetyl-CoA metabolic cycle of denitrifying biomass. This allows for immediate utilization without requiring adaptation periods, in contrast to complex sugars or alcohols which must first undergo enzymatic breakdown.

Different industrial activities generate distinct wastewater profiles. Smedic's product range is formulated to address these specific operational demands:
POME is characterized by high organic strength, acidic pH, and significant nitrogen concentrations. In biological treatment ponds, adding a reliable external carbon source like sodium acetate helps accelerate denitrification rates, keeping total nitrogen levels within local regulatory limits.
Textile wastewater along the Citarum River basin often contains complex polymers, dyes, and heavy metals. Our inorganic-organic covalent bond flocculants and heavy metal precipitants help break down chemical complexes and remove heavy metals, improving primary clarifier efficiency.
Municipal WWTPs in urban areas like Jakarta must manage variable flow rates and low C:N ratios. Applying high-purity carbon sources supports stable denitrification, helping plants maintain consistent nitrate removal rates during peak loading periods.
